Where India flies from.
Operational airports with scheduled commercial service, ranked by FY 2025-26 passenger throughput from AAI.
At a glance
- 01India's airports together handled 420.1 million passengers in FY 2025-26, per AAI.
- 02Delhi (IGIA) remained busiest at 78.7 million passengers, ahead of Mumbai and Bengaluru.
- 03The top five airports account for about 55% of all-India passenger traffic in the displayed year.
- 0438 of the airports listed are designated international airports, with the remainder either customs airports or domestic-only.
